Research Interests
I have an abiding interest in redesigning the delivery of care to improve outcomes in patients with chronic rheumatic diseases. My experience and expertise in process redesign and health information technology has allowed our Rheumatology Department, to work on a number of exciting and cutting edge projects designed to create more patient-centric, higher quality, and more efficient health care and patient outcomes.Recent Publications
